What is a Slot Machine?

A slot machine, often referred to as a fruit machine or a pokie, is a gambling device that generates random combinations of symbols on virtual reels. Players insert coins or credits and spin the reels, hoping for a winning combination. The excitement lies in the uncertainty of outcomes, as players anticipate either modest rewards or life-changing jackpots. Slot machines typically feature themes ranging from classic fruit symbols to state-of-the-art graphics inspired by popular culture, movies, and adventures.

The Evolution of Slot Machines Over the Years

Originating in the late 19th century, slot machines have undergone significant transformations. The first mechanical slot machine, designed by Charles Fey in 1895, featured three reels with five symbols: horseshoes, diamonds, spades, hearts, and the Liberty Bell. Fast forward to the late 20th century, and the introduction of video slots revolutionized the industry. Modern slot machines now incorporate advanced technology, allowing for innovative gameplay, progressive jackpots, and complex bonus features that enhance player engagement.

How Slot Machines Work: A Deep Dive

At the core of every slot machine is a Random Number Generator (RNG) that ensures each spin is independent and fair. The RNG generates thousands of random numbers per second, even when the machine is not being played. When a player spins the reels, the RNG determines the outcome, creating a unique combination of symbols. While players often believe that certain strategies or timing can influence results, each spin is purely chance-driven, making it crucial for players to manage their expectations and play responsibly.

Identifying Slot Addiction: Signs and Symptoms

Slot addiction, a form of gambling disorder, can manifest in various ways. Common signs include:

  • Inability to limit the time or money spent on slot machines
  • Chasing losses or increasing bets to recover lost money
  • Neglecting personal relationships and responsibilities due to gambling
  • Experiencing anxiety or restlessness when not gambling

If you or someone you know exhibits these symptoms, it may be time to seek help from a professional or support group.

Common Misconceptions About Slot Machines

There are numerous myths surrounding slot machines that can mislead players. Some of the most common include:

  • Hot and cold machines: Many players believe that some machines are “due” for a win while others are “cold.” In reality, each spin is random and independent of previous outcomes.
  • Timing affects outcomes: Some believe that timing the spin can impact results. Again, outcomes are determined by the RNG, and timing has no effect.
  • Higher bets mean better odds: Betting more does not guarantee better odds; it simply increases potential payouts if you win.

Understanding the facts helps dispel these myths and encourages responsible gaming.
